Sidewalk repair services typically cover a range of work aimed at restoring safety and functionality to pedestrian walkways. This can include fixing cracks, uneven surfaces, and broken sections, as well as addressing issues caused by tree roots or ground shifting. Contractors may also handle full replacements of damaged slabs or the installation of new concrete to improve the appearance and safety of sidewalks. Understanding the scope of these services helps property owners determine what repairs are necessary and ensures that the work addresses both immediate safety concerns and long-term durability.

- Assess the extent of sidewalk damage, such as cracks, uneven surfaces, or heaving, to determine the scope of repair needed. - Consider how well local contractors explain their proposed work and scope in writing for clarity.
- Verify the experience of service providers with sidewalk repair projects similar in size and complexity. - Look for contractors who provide detailed descriptions of their previous work and expertise.
- Compare the methods and materials recommended by different service providers to ensure they align with the repair requirements. - Ensure that scope of work and materials are clearly outlined in written proposals.
- Check whether contractors identify potential underlying issues, such as soil instability or drainage problems, that could affect repair longevity. - Confirm that these considerations are documented in the scope of work.
- Review the warranties or guarantees offered by local contractors to understand what is covered post-repair. - Make sure warranty details are provided in writing before proceeding.
- Ensure that the scope of work includes cleanup and final inspection to verify the quality of sidewalk repairs. - Clarify these expectations are documented in the repair agreement.

How can I compare sidewalk repair contractors effectively? To compare local service providers, review their experience, verify references, and assess their scope of work to ensure they meet the specific needs of the project.
What should I consider when defining the scope of sidewalk repair? Clearly outline the extent of damage, desired repair outcomes, and any specific materials or methods to ensure the contractor understands the project requirements.
How do I verify a contractor’s experience with sidewalk repairs? Ask for details about previous projects, request references, and check for any relevant work history related to sidewalk repair or similar services.
Why is it important to have a written agreement with a sidewalk repair contractor? A written agreement helps set clear expectations, defines the scope of work, and provides a record of the project details to prevent misunderstandings.
What questions should I ask a contractor before hiring for sidewalk repair? Inquire about their experience, the methods they use, the materials involved, and how they handle potential issues that may arise during the repair process.
How can I ensure the contractor understands my sidewalk repair expectations? Communicate your project goals clearly, ask for a detailed scope of work in writing, and confirm that all aspects of the repair are documented before work begins.
